The Baltimore Police Department is investigating a fatal shooting on Sept. 27 along N. Smallwood Avenue.

Officers were called to the 1600 block of N. Smallwood Avenue around 5:35 p.m. on Monday for a shot-spotter alert. When they arrived, police found a man with multiple gunshot wounds.

The victim was taken to Shock Trauma, where he later died from his injuries.

To report any information, call homicide detectives at 410-396-2100 or Metro Crime Stoppers at 1-866-7lockup.
